What's the difference between chiropractic and physical therapy for neck pain?+
Chiropractic focuses on spinal alignment and joint mobility; PT emphasizes exercise and functional movement. Dr. Stubbs integrates rehab exercises into neck pain care - combining both approaches for Austin TX 78738 patients.

Can a chiropractor prescribe prednisone?+
No. Chiropractors in Texas are not licensed to prescribe medications, including prednisone. Chiropractic is drug-free by design. In Texas, only MDs, DOs, nurse practitioners, and PAs with prescriptive authority can prescribe pharmaceuticals. What are red flags for chiropractors?+
Red flags include requiring long-term prepaid contracts, guaranteeing cures for non-musculoskeletal conditions, taking X-rays unnecessarily before an exam, discouraging medical referrals, and high-pressure sales tactics at the first visit.
